As established during our “Basic Systematic Materials Selection” course, designers and engineers need to consider materials during design and can use materials selection methodology to do so. But design is often focused on the performance of a product. So how can we ensure our materials will perform as intended in our final product?

In this Ansys Innovation Course, “Intro to Performance Indices,” we will expand on the materials selection methodology introduced in the “Basic Systematic Materials Selection” course and introduce the concept of performance indices, or a single material property or group of properties that represent the performance of our design. By using performance indices alongside the methodology during the design process, one can ensure that all the design requirements and performance needs are accounted for.

This course will cover:

    • The definition of performance indices.
    • How to derive performance indices using design requirements.
  • How to apply performance indices during materials selection using Ansys Granta EduPack.
  • An example case study of materials selection with performance indices for the deck of a longboard.
